Binance Staked SOL Use Cases
Liquidity and Flexibility: Binance Staked SOL (BNSOL) allows users to maintain the liquidity of their staked SOL tokens while earning staking rewards. Unlike traditional staking, where tokens are locked for a specific period, BNSOL provides flexibility by enabling users to trade, lend, and use their staked assets on Binance and external DeFi platforms.
Trading and Transferability: BNSOL represents staked SOL plus the staking rewards received, in a tradable and transferable form. This means users can sell, transfer, or use their staked SOL position without having to wait for the staking period to end.
External DeFi Applications: Users can move BNSOL to a personal wallet and use it outside the Binance platform while still earning rewards. This includes participating in Solana-based protocols that support the liquid staking token, such as MarginFi, Solayer, Pyth, Orca, and others.
Redemption and Withdrawal: BNSOL can be redeemed at any time, either by trading it for other assets or after a waiting period. Users can also withdraw BNSOL to Binance Web3 Wallet and explore various Solana-based protocols.

Benefits of Binance Staked SOL
- Flexibility: Binance Staked SOL allows users to stake their SOL while still having access to their assets through a liquid token called BNSOL. This means users can use their staked assets in various DeFi protocols without having to unlock them.
- High Performance: The Solana network, on which BNSOL operates, is known for its high throughput and low transaction costs. This enables quick transactions and efficient reward distribution, making it one of the fastest blockchains available.
- Low Fees: The low transaction costs on the Solana network mean that users can stake and unstake their assets without incurring significant fees, enhancing the overall profitability of staking activities.
- Decentralization and Security: Solana employs a unique consensus mechanism called Proof of History (PoH), which enhances security and decentralization. This ensures that the staking process is not only efficient but also secure against potential attacks.
Considerations and Potential Drawbacks
- Inflationary Nature: Solana's inflationary issuances can dilute the value of SOL tokens over time. This is a risk that investors should be aware of when staking SOL.
- Staking Yields: The staking yields are primarily a function of the fraction of SOL that is staked on the network. Rewards are distributed across delegated staking accounts and validator vote accounts per the validator commission rate. However, the exact staking yields can only be estimated as the amount of total SOL that will be staked is unknown.
- Commission Rates: Validators charge a fee or commission on inflationary rewards earned by the stake accounts that are delegated to them. These fees are in exchange for their services in securing the blockchain and processing transactions. Depending on the commission rate, this could impact the net staking yield for an investor.
- Comparison with Other Staking Options: Solana offers faster transaction speeds and lower costs compared to Ethereum, but its staking rewards may not be as high as those offered by Cardano. This makes it important for investors to consider their individual investment goals and risk tolerance when deciding whether to stake Solana.

Halal Status of Binance Staked SOL
- Halal Status: Yes
- Reason: Binance Staked SOL is considered halal because staking SOL does not involve guaranteed returns, which would constitute riba (interest), a practice prohibited in Islamic finance. The staking rewards are based on the validator’s performance and the overall contribution to the network, making it permissible under Shariah principles.
